Crispr/cas9-mediated mutagenesis of brleafy delays the bolting time in chinese cabbage (brassica rapa l. ssp. pekinensis)

HIGHLIGHTS

  • who: Yun-Hee Shin and Young-Doo Park from the Department of Horticultural Biotechnology, Kyung University, Deogyoung-daero, Giheung-gu, Yongin-si, Gyeonggi-do, Republic of Korea have published the Article: CRISPR/Cas9-Mediated Mutagenesis of BrLEAFY Delays the Bolting Time in Chinese Cabbage (Brassica rapa L. ssp. pekinensis), in the Journal: (JOURNAL) of 10/04/2019
  • what: In this study late-bolting Chinese cabbage lines were developed via of the BrLEAFY (BrLFY) a transcription factor that determines floral identity using the clustered regularly interspaced short palindromic repeat (CRISPR)/CRISPR-associated protein 9 (CRISPR/Cas9 . . .
